Excerpt from Memoirs of James Robert Hope-Scott of Abbotsford, Vol. 1 of 2: With Selections From His Correspondence A Few Observations Only are required by way of introduction to the Second Edition of these Memoirs. I have carefully revised the whole, but have made no changes that appear to require notice beyond the correction of clerical or typographical errors, and of a few mistakes as to matters of fact, the instances in all three classes being generally of small moment. I have also been able to decipher here and there a word which had formerly baffled me in the MSS. I have taken this opportunity of introducing a few additional documents of interest, especially an important letter of Mr. Gladstone's to Mr. Hope-Scott on his own early political career, for the use of which, with some other fresh extracts from their correspondence, I have to express my best thanks. A letter has also been added from the Hodgkin papers, which did not reach me in time for the First Edition, throwing further light on the Anglican period of Mr. Hope-Scott's religious history. Some striking passages from an article on Mr. Hope-Scott, contributed to Macmillans Magazine by Sir Francis Hastings Doyle, have been inserted, and an early letter of Sir Francis to Mr. Hope, relating a touching incident connected with the death of Arthur Hallam.
